Ysleta Heck
Ysleta Heck, 76, passed away Saturday, June 8, 2002 in Midwest City, Okla. She was born Jan. 4, 1926 in Mt. Park, Okla., to Lee and Naomi (Lunsford) Watson.
She was employed as an administrative secretary with Tinker AFB for 36 years before retiring in 1989. She was a member of the First Southern Baptist Church.
She is survived by one daughter, Sherri Dixson and husband Chuck of Oklahoma City; one brother, Loyd Wayne Watson and wife June of Denver, Colo.; two sisters, Virginia Weitner of Sara Vista, Ariz. and Asalee Santilli of Midwest City. She is preceded in death by her parents; two sisters, Corine Harty and Velma Webber; and one brother, Earl Watson.
Funeral services were held at 10 a.m. Wednesday, June 12, in the Resthaven Funeral Home Chapel with interment following in Resthaven Memory Gardens.
